Does PPO Insurance Cover Luxury Rehab in Los Angeles? Your California Guide

You found this page because someone you love needs help, or because you need it yourself. You're carrying the weight of that knowledge and the dread of a number you haven't seen yet. That fear is real. So is the answer you're looking for. Your PPO insurance plan likely covers medically supervised detox and drug and alcohol rehab in California, including inpatient rehab at a luxury treatment center in Los Angeles. This guide explains exactly how, what to expect, and what protections you have.

Key takeaways

  • PPO insurance covers the clinical treatment (medically supervised detox, therapy, psychiatric support), not the luxury amenities at a private rehab facility.
  • California's SB-855 (2020) requires your PPO plan to cover substance use disorder treatment at full parity with medical care.
  • A co-occurring mental health condition alongside addiction often strengthens, not weakens, your medical necessity case with insurers.
  • Insurance verification for rehab typically takes 24 to 48 hours, and a qualified admissions team should handle this for you.

Luxury Residential Rehab in Los Angeles: Dual Diagnosis Care

You don't drink to get drunk. You drink to get quiet. To slow the noise, soften the edge of a day that wouldn't let up. That's a story worth sitting with—because what it's pointing at has a name, a clinical profile, and a treatment designed specifically for it.

Key takeaways

  • Co-occurring anxiety and alcohol use disorder affect roughly 1 in 5 people seeking treatment for either condition alone (Turner et al., 2018).
  • Treating addiction without addressing underlying trauma measurably increases relapse risk—integrated treatment produces better outcomes (Mangrum et al., 2006).
  • Federal law protects your job while you're in residential treatment — most people don't know that, and it changes everything (U.S. Department of Labor, 29 CFR § 825.119).
  • What separates a real luxury addiction treatment center from an expensive backdrop is clinical depth—structure, integration, and care built around the whole person.
